Background

The bone removal of whole fish is a high-grade technique for making traditional Chinese dishes, and because the traditional technique is not well-passed, cooks who can remove bone without hurting fish and skin have had more fingers. The soup-filled yellow croaker in the full-length Manhan mat can be perfectly presented only by the whole fish boning removing technique, but as almost no one can master the technique, the soup-filled yellow croaker can only make a simplified version of the open-pored yellow croaker, and the flavor and interest of the soup-filled yellow croaker are certainly not preserved. Even if a master with skilled knife workers prepares the dish, great manpower and labor hour are consumed, and the preparation amount of hotel hospitalization places with a certain scale is difficult to meet the requirements of customers. According to the statistics of the applicant, if a master teacher skilled in a cutter is employed to perform full-time bone removal on the whole yellow croaker, the processing amount of about 20 yellow croakers can be completed.

In view of this, the applicant designs a method for removing bones from whole fish, which can rapidly remove the bones of the fish by using a tool without damaging the fish body, is suitable for industrial assembly line operation, and meets the eating requirements of customers.

Detailed Description

The present invention will be described in further detail with reference to the accompanying drawings and specific embodiments.

The invention relates to a method for boning whole fish, which comprises the following steps:

(1) cleaning large yellow croakers to be treated for later use;

(2) inserting two chopsticks shown in fig. 1 into the abdominal cavity from the mouth of a fish respectively, wherein the gill and the viscera of the fish are positioned in a clamping gap of the two chopsticks; rotating the two chopsticks for at least one circle while keeping the clamping gap during insertion, and stripping the gill and the viscera of the fish from the belly of the fish; then the two chopsticks clamp the gill and the viscera of the fish and are separated from the mouth of the fish;

(3) extending a long-handle spoon shown in fig. 2 into the belly of the fish from the mouth of the fish, and scraping out roes and viscera residues in the belly of the fish by using a spoon head;

(4) inserting a peeling shovel shown in fig. 3 and 4 into the fish belly twice from the fish mouth, and peeling both sides of the fish bone from the inner side of the fish belly;

(5) inserting the elbow scissors shown in figures 7 and 8 into the deep part of the fish belly from the fish mouth until the tail end of the fish bone is reached, and then cutting the tail end of the fish bone by using the elbow scissors;

(6) using a straight head shear shown in figures 5 and 6 to stretch into the fish from the lower part of the gill, and shearing off the joint of the front end of the fish bone and the fish head part;

(7) the elbow clamp shown in fig. 9 and 10 is extended into the abdomen of the fish from the fish mouth, and then the fishbone is entirely clamped out.

As shown in fig. 1, a chopstick gap fixer is also included in the step (2). The chopstick gap fixer comprises a connecting rod, and two ends of the connecting rod are respectively provided with a fixing ring; when the two chopsticks are rotated to strip the gill and the viscera of the fish, the exposed ends of the two chopsticks can be respectively inserted into the two fixing rings to keep a clamping gap. The length of connecting rod is adjustable and can fix the length after adjusting. The connecting rod can adopt a plug-in mounting combination mode, and the structure is as follows: a left threaded cylinder is transversely arranged on the right side of the left fixing ring, a right threaded cylinder is arranged on the left transverse line of the right fixing ring, and double-headed reverse studs are arranged in the left threaded cylinder and the right threaded cylinder. When the double-end reverse stud is rotated in the forward direction, the distance between the fixing rings on the left side and the right side can be increased; when the double-end reverse stud is reversely rotated, the distance between the fixing rings on the left side and the right side can be shortened. The sizes and specifications of common yellow croakers to be treated in the same batch are similar, the length of the connecting rod can be adjusted, and the yellow croakers in the whole batch are more convenient to treat and use, so that the method is suitable for being operated and applied by unskilled workers.

The peeling shovel comprises a flaky shovel handle and a shovel head, the shovel head is connected with the front end of the shovel handle, and an arc-shaped cutting edge is arranged at the front end of the shovel head.

The bone removing technique is more convenient to operate, does not need skillful operation skills, and can quickly remove the fish bone by using a tool without hurting the fish body. The applicant originally creates a peeling shovel easy for double-sided boning, which is particularly suitable for separating two sides of a fishbone from a fish body, and the flat shovel head with the arc-shaped cutting edge can perfectly remove bone slices only by being inserted between the fishbone and the fish body and swinging left and right, so that the operation is simple and easy to learn, the shovel head is suitable for industrialized production line operation, and the edible requirements of customers are met.

Through statistics, when the bone removing method is used for treating the yellow croakers, a novice can also treat about 160 yellow croakers every day. The processed yellow croaker is in a perfect cylindrical shape, can be filled with soup and filler, has uniform fish meat flavor during cooking and complete shape, can completely meet the daily supply of hotels above a scale, is suitable for popularization in the industry, and contributes to the inheritance and the promotion of the traditional Chinese dish skills.
